The original “Dreamcatcher” necklaces were designed by Native American’s, more specifically the Ojibwa Nation. The “Dreamcatcher” symbolized unity during the Pan-Indian Movement of the 60’s and 70’s. Although they were a symbol of unity, the history behind the Dreamcatcher originates from the traditions of the Ojibwa Nation.

“Dreamcatchers” were objects which were made from personal and sacred items. The Native American version was handmade and based upon a willow hoop which had a woven net within the hoop. The net was then decorated with personal and sacred items which helped infants, children and adults get a good night’s sleep. The theory was that bad dreams would pass through the holes in the net and the good dreams would be captured in the net, slide through the personal items in the web and transfer to the person.

Leather cuffs and bracelets for summer into fall

Leather cuffs and leather bracelets have been huge the past few seasons. Although, for summer 2012 and for fall 2012 leather cuffs and leather bracelets are exploding as arguably the most popular bracelet style on the street.

While not dominant on the runways, designers and jewelry brands alike have been designing and selling their own versions of the rocker chic leather bracelet. Fashionistas have flocked to the jewelry style over the past few seasons and the trend has taken off for summer 2012 and fall 2012.

Leather cuffs and bracelets have been shown in every color, type of leather and faux leather imaginable. Exotic skins, plain leather and faux leather are being shown on hard cuffs, soft bracelets and soft wrap bracelets.

Cuff bracelets which are made from leather are mainly being shown in smooth, understated styles. The unembellished cuffs are usually made from metal and feature leather or faux leather stretched around the outside to create a non-shiny, understated jewelry piece which is colorful and playful.

Bracelets made from leather and faux leather are anything but plain. Leather bracelets are shown with studs and embellishments for summer and fall. Leather bracelets for summer and fall offer rock n’ roll style as well as hardcore chic. The bracelets are shown as a traditional, once around style or as a wrap style which can go around the wrist anywhere from two to four times.

Leather cuffs and leather bracelets are also popular on the street as part of the stacked bracelet trend. Fashionistas love to stack about three bracelets on their arms and in general, one of these bracelets is made from leather and offers a spiky, rock n’ roll feel.
